[ background art ]
According to international standards, urban rail transit trains can be divided into A, B, C types, which correspond to train widths of 3 meters, 2.8 meters and 2.6 meters respectively. In the assembly and debugging stages of the train, a single-layer or double-layer fixed platform is often needed, and the distance between the platforms is determined according to the width of the train. If the distance is too large, the gap between the platform and the train is too large, and potential safety hazards exist; if the distance is too small, the production and manufacturing of trains with three widths cannot be met.

[ detailed description of the invention ]
The invention is further described below with reference to the accompanying drawings:
As shown in the attached drawings 1-5, the utility model comprises a fixed platform 1 and a supporting upright post 2 supporting the fixed platform, wherein a main frame of the fixed platform 1 is formed by welding channel steel, and a hyacinth bean checkered plate is welded on the upper surface. The supporting upright post 2 is formed by welding a square steel pipe and an end steel plate, one end of the supporting upright post is connected with the ground through an expansion bolt, and the other end of the supporting upright post is connected with the bottom of the fixed platform 1 through a bolt. Fixed platform 1 one side is provided with guardrail 3, fixed platform 1 upper surface is opened has a plurality of bar direction installing port 417, drive installing port 418, install direction supporting mechanism 410 in the direction installing port 417, actuating mechanism 420 is equipped with in the drive installing port 418, direction supporting mechanism 410 and actuating mechanism 420 cooperation are connected moving platform 4. The moving platform 4 can realize telescopic movement through a plurality of sets of guiding and supporting mechanisms 410 and driving mechanisms 420.
The guide supporting mechanism 410 comprises a guide rail 413, a sliding block 416, a sliding block seat 414 and a guide rail connecting seat 415, the sliding block seat 414 is fixedly connected with the lower end face of the fixed platform 1, the sliding block 416 is arranged in the sliding block seat 414, the sliding block 416 is slidably connected with the guide rail 413, the guide rail 413 is fixedly connected with the guide rail connecting seat 415, and the upper end of the guide rail connecting seat 415 penetrates through a guide mounting opening 417 and is fixedly connected with the lower end face of the movable platform 4.
the driving mechanism 420 comprises an air cylinder and a driving control system, the air cylinder is connected with the driving control system through a line, the air cylinder is installed at the driving installation port 418 of the fixed platform 1, and the piston end of the air cylinder is connected with the lower end face of the movable platform 4 in a matching mode. Nylon pads 412 are arranged on two sides of the guide rail connecting seat 415 on the lower end surface of the moving platform 4, and are used for assisting in supporting the moving platform plate 411. The moving platform plate 411 of the moving platform 4 is a hyacinth bean pattern plate, and the outer edge of the moving platform plate 411 is bent downwards.
The guardrail 3 is provided with a continuous skirting board 301 with a certain height, so that objects on the platform can be prevented from rolling down the platform.
